Catacombs of Kom El Shoqafa
The Catacombs of Kom El Shoqafa is a Greco-Roman tomb for a single greek family that dates to the 2n century BC. It has three floors filled with great decorations from the early Roman and Hellenistic eras.
Pompey's Pillar
Pompey’s pillar was carved around 300 AD for the Roman emperor Diocletian. It is 33.85 m high and made of granite and is rumored to possess the remains of general Pompey.

Alexandria Library
The Bibliotheca Alexandria was opened to the public in 2002 to keep the spirit of the ancient library alive. It possesses the sixth biggest francophone library on earth plus a number of inner museums, art galleries, and many more.
The Qaitbay Citadel is a majestic Islamic fortress constructed by Mamluk Sultan Al-Ashraf Sayf al-Din Qa'it Bay in 1447 AD across the coast of the Mediterranean Sea on the exact location that contained one of the seven wonders of the ancient world Lighthouse of Alexandria.
